Beautiful pictures of the jellies. Did you rely on the public aquarium lights or did you use your own strobe? The light seems to change between pictures.
Wampatom, I relied solely on the ambient light which was usually very dim. The only exception is the last photo, where the lighting was significantly brighter and the jelly was housed in a tank with blue background. Everything was spot metered.

Travis, I shot these with ISO @ 800, F2.8, 1/15-1/30 second shutter, and monopod mounted. All were spot metered. I had to take a bunch of photos to get a few to turn out. Next time, I'm going with a tripod and a few other lens; these were just snap-shooting, but I got lucky on a few.
